Understanding ADHD and the Role of a Psychiatrist
ADHD is a complicated condition that needs a complex approach to treatment. Psychiatrists, who are medical doctors specializing in mental health, play a vital function in detecting and dealing with ADHD. They can prescribe medications, use psychiatric therapy, and offer continuous assistance to assist people handle their signs and enhance their lifestyle.
Actions to Finding a Psychiatrist Near You
Research study and Recommendations
Ask for Referrals: Start by asking your medical care physician, good friends, or relative for recommendations. They might understand of a trusted psychiatrist who concentrates on ADHD.Online Directories: Utilize online directory sites such as the American Psychiatric Association (APA) or Psychology Today to find psychiatrists in your location. These platforms typically provide comprehensive profiles, including specializeds, insurance coverage accepted, and patient reviews.
Validate Credentials
Examine Qualifications: Ensure that the psychiatrist is board-certified in psychiatry. This indicates that they have finished the essential training and have actually passed the accreditation examination.Expertise: Look for a psychiatrist who has experience and a particular concentrate on dealing with ADHD. This proficiency can make a significant distinction in the efficiency of the treatment.
Insurance coverage and Costs
Insurance coverage Coverage: Verify whether the psychiatrist accepts your insurance. If not, inquire about their fees and payment options. Some psychiatrists may offer sliding scale charges based on earnings.Initial Consultation: Many psychiatrists offer initial assessments to discuss your signs, treatment choices, and any issues you might have. This is an excellent opportunity to assess whether you feel comfortable with the psychiatrist.
Place and Accessibility
Proximity: Consider the place of the psychiatrist's office. Select a place that is hassle-free for you to go to routinely, especially if you will be undergoing long-term treatment.Telehealth Options: With the rise of telehealth, numerous psychiatrists offer virtual assessments. Preliminary Assessment
Case history: The psychiatrist will likely request for a comprehensive medical history, consisting of any previous diagnoses, medications, and treatments.Sign Evaluation: You will be asked to describe your symptoms, their period, and how they impact your life. This may include completing surveys or scales to assess the intensity of your ADHD.
Diagnosis
Comprehensive Evaluation: The psychiatrist will carry out a comprehensive evaluation to identify if you satisfy the diagnostic criteria for ADHD. This may include a physical examination, psychological tests, and possibly input from member of the family or teachers.Differential Diagnosis: ADHD can sometimes be misinterpreted for other conditions, such as stress and anxiety or depression. The psychiatrist will eliminate other potential causes of your symptoms.
Treatment Plan

Q: What should I search for in a psychiatrist who treats ADHD?
A: Look for a psychiatrist who is board-certified, has experience in dealing with ADHD, and offers a thorough technique to treatment, including medication, therapy, and way of life suggestions.
Q: How can I verify a psychiatrist's credentials?
A: You can validate a psychiatrist's credentials through the American Board of Psychiatry and Neurology (ABPN) or the state medical board where the psychiatrist practices.
Q: What if I don't have insurance coverage?
A: If you do not have insurance, many psychiatrists offer moving scale charges based upon earnings. You can also explore community health centers or centers that offer mental health services at a decreased cost.
Q: What questions should I ask throughout the preliminary assessment?
A: Ask about the psychiatrist's experience with ADHD, their treatment viewpoint, the kinds of medications they recommend, and what to expect during the treatment process. It's likewise important to talk about any concerns or choices you may have.
Q: Can I see a psychiatrist for ADHD if I reside in a remote area?
A: Yes, lots of psychiatrists use telehealth services, permitting you to receive treatment from the convenience of your home. Guarantee that the psychiatrist is accredited to practice in your state.
